Marciana Logu was born in Shkoder, Albania, and moved to the United States as a young child. She became a United States citizen at age 19 and pursued her dream to become an attorney. She attained her Associates in Criminal Justice from Keiser University and then received her Bachelor’s Degree in Legal Studies from the University of Central Florida. She attended Florida Coastal School of Law and was elected to the Student Bar Association while also being co-chair of the Multicultural Affairs Committee. Marciana graduated with her Juris Doctorate and was licensed by the Florida Bar in 2016.
Marciana has prior experience practicing immigration, civil, traffic, and divorce law but she joined Ron Sholes, P.A. in 2018, dedicating herself solely to personal injury. She prides herself in giving aggressive representation to all clients and in being the voice for those who may not otherwise have one. She applied to Ron Sholes, P.A. because of the firm’s dedication to personal representation and service to the community.
Marciana is a member of the Young Lawyers section and provides pro bono service regularly. She participates in Jacksonville Legal Aide’s annual pro bono Citizenship Day, where they help permanent residents apply for citizenship.
